Law enforcement interrogation of terrorism suspects introduction when terrorism suspects are captured or arrested, it is important for the united states to learn all that it can from these individuals to prevent future attacks and gain knowledge about terrorist groups and others plotting to harm the country. Rex applegate june 21, 1914 july 14, 1998 was an american military officer who worked for the office of strategic services, where he trained allied special forces personnel in closequarters combat during world war ii. Power projection is the ability of a military force to deploy air, land, and sea forces to any region of the world and to sustain them for any type of mission.
